Transaction 25512d72b219f07748bc64167467f2738f8661506a84e883344795a643a7da92

1 Input
1 Outputs
  • 25512d72b219f07748bc64167467f2738f8661506a84e883344795a643a7da92:0
  • value  67996719
    address  1MKrMxThP33AmA4Q6BrP5BpzDAVxVJ26ca